Ovarian transcriptomic study reveals the differential regulation of miRNAs and lncRNAs related to fecundity in different sheep
Explore this paper's citation graph
Summary
This is the first study performing thorough investigations of regulatory relationships among lncRNAs, miRNA and m RNAs, which will provide a novel view of the regulatory mechanisms involved in sheep fecundity.
